Quote:
Originally Posted by skuzzlebutt5 View Post
just wondering if 215/55/16 would work on these. lowering about 1'' thanks.
215/55/16 are huge tires, stick to 195/50/16, 205/45/16, or if you really want 215mm wide - 215/45/16.

But to your question, with the tires I mentioned above and the offset of your wheels, no problems when lowering 1".
